Electrical Shift Engineer- FM Service Provider - Days & Nights - Canary Wharf

Fantastic opportunity to work for a leading FM Service provider situated in London.

Skilled Careers are currently recruiting for an Electrical Shift Engineer to work on a commercial building in Canary Wharf

He or she will provide an exceptional high standard of building services provision (planned and reactive) within a corporate commercial, occupied environment and with the utmost regard for customer service.

You will be responsible for undertaking planned and reactive maintenance works to Electrical, HVAC plant and associated equipment.

The successful candidate will be electrically qualified, have a proven track record in commercial building maintenance and will be required to liaise with clients, other service partners and contract support functions throughout the business via telephone and email, therefore excellent communication and computer operation skills are a requirement for this position.

Hours of work

4 on 4 off - Days & Nights

** 07:00am to 19:00pm & 19:00pm to 07:00am **

Key duties & Responsibilities

Establish good working relationships with the client Facilities Management Team, to ensure proactive, open, and co-operative partnership

Monitor component, system and building performance against target profiles via Building Management System and alert platform

Supervise, coordinate and manage the Site Technicians, ensuring that the Operational Team undertake PPM or reactive works in accordance with the agreed timescale, providing technical support and leadership for the site technicians.

Operate all systems within the buildings in a competent, effective and efficient manner.

Contribute information as required for regular and exception reports

Propose variations or modifications to modes of operation and or the times of operation of systems to minimise energy consumption

Invoke escalation when required through established communication channels

Ensure required documentation and records are maintained in line with company processes and procedures.

Responsible for incident management and completion of associated forms

Ensure the shift log is kept up to date with relative and informed information that proactively assists the shift Team deliver to a constant high standard.

Ensure the shift handover report is submitted before the end of shift without exception

Ensure all asset and operational issues are clearly recorded to meet contractual KPI’s and SLA’s

Develop a comprehensive understanding of the building layout, functions, and complexities through developed practices through scenario drills, continuous assessments, staff training and personal development

Ensure a consistent and up to date understanding of site and asset operational status, utilising the Building Management System and Shift Team

Requirements

Electrically qualified

City & Guilds 2382 18th Edition IEE Regulations

Experienced in the Electrical aspects of general building Planned Preventative Maintenance (PPM) schedules

Competent working knowledge of HVAP, Air Handling Unit, Building Management Systems, Air Conditioning equipment, Cold Water systems, Heating and Ventilation systems, Water Treatment UPS, and Emergency Generators

Safe system of Work Procedure – PTW, RAMS etc (Desirable)

Strong technical background
